Sialkot, Aug 11 (APP):The livestock department Pasrur started a vaccination campaign to protect livestock from Haemorrhagic Septicaemia, locally known as “Gal Ghotu,” during the monsoon.
Assistant Director Dr Aqil Sohail said trained veterinary teams are administering vaccines door-to-door to cattle using long needles for effective protection.
He urged farmers to cooperate by restraining animals. The campaign will continue in the current and the next months.
